What the vulnerability does
01Description
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F) vulnerability in emendo_seb Co-marquage service-public.fr co-marquage-service-public allows Cross Site Request Forgery.This issue affects Co-marquage service-public.fr: from n/a through <= 0.5.77.
Explanation of Vulnerability in Simple Terms
02Summary
The Co-marquage service-public.fr component versions 0.5.77 and earlier are vulnerable to cross-site request forgery (CSRF). An attacker can craft a malicious webpage that, when visited by a logged-in site administrator, performs unwanted actions on the site without their knowledge. The vulnerability requires user interaction and does not expose sensitive data, but can modify site content or settings.
What an attacker can do
03Attacker Capabilities
Trick a logged-in admin into visiting a malicious page that performs unwanted actions on the site.
Potential impact on your site
04Site Impact
Unauthorized changes to site content or settings if an admin visits a malicious link.
Conditions required to exploit
05Prerequisites
Admin must visit attacker-controlled webpage while logged into the site.
